Output 50a5ed31c88dc44234c34faf2101025b4a77fc07a2eff98360525b3b0925511a:2

value
1489839
script pubkey
OP_0 OP_PUSHBYTES_20 bbfdbb95c9709159a9996009ae40ca6682fc6ff1
address
ltc1qh07mh9wfwzg4n2vevqy6usx2v6p0cml3wvc6xt
transaction
50a5ed31c88dc44234c34faf2101025b4a77fc07a2eff98360525b3b0925511a
spent
true